Individuals regularly using the internet
Ireland, 2025
In 2025, Ireland's individuals regularly using the internet increased by 1.1% compared to 2024, reaching 99.7.
Ireland accounts for 107.5% of the EU-27 total of 92.7.
Ireland ranks 1st out of 27 EU member states with reported data — in the top half of the distribution.
Over the past five years, the indicator has grown by 11.6% (from 89.3 in 2020).
